**Q: How is Lanternkit versioned?**

Semver, strictly. Breaking changes to any exported component bump the major. Minor for new components or props, patch for fixes. We cut releases every Tuesday; no ad-hoc publishes without sign-off from the Platform Guild. Pin to a minor range in app repos — never use latest. Deprecations get two minor versions of warning before removal, announced in the sync notes. Migration codemods ship with every major. The full versioning policy and release calendar live here:

operations page: https://jenkins.zemvarcloud.local/job/merge_requests/repo/build/73930b4b30f0a8ed

Subject: Key rotation for Chatterbox log sampling

Welcome aboard. As part of onboarding, please note we rotated the credential that the Fenwick log-sampler uses to throttle Chatterbox's output. Chatterbox emits roughly forty thousand lines a minute, so the sampler keeps only one in two hundred outside of incidents. The old key stops working Friday; update your local config before then. For your setup, the new sampler key follows.

API key for fahif-bahop: vxb23-B1zKyQaAnaG4Gma9WuizPfB

Runbook: undo/redo in the Slatewing diagram editor. Each user action is recorded as an inverse operation on a per-session stack; stacks are held server-side and purged on logout. Redo history clears whenever a new action lands. For the security review, note that undo entries may contain element text, so retention matters. Stack depth, retention window, and purge cadence are governed by the following values.

settings of tagef-bawif:
DRUIX_HOST=druix.zemvarlabs.internal
DRUIX_PORT=8000

Document Transport — Safe Replacement Lock

The replacement lock assembly for the Ordmere office safe travels as a controlled item. Keep it in its sealed manufacturer box, do not open it at the dispatch desk, and record the transfer in the secure-items ledger. Only the designated locksmith at Ordmere may receive it. The courier hand-over instruction appears directly below.

drop instructions, yafog-yawip: the quenmir olidor courier leaves the julox tamion keliel ledger at gate 5283 under passcode 336825